Educator for Special Needs Students

RESPONSIBILITIES:

1. Instructs designated classes at assigned locations and times.

2. Develops a tailored curriculum that addresses the unique needs, interests, and abilities of each student.

3. Establishes a learning environment that fosters engagement and is suitable for the developmental stages of the students.

4. Directs the educational process to achieve established curriculum objectives, clearly communicating goals for all lessons, units, and projects.

5. Prepares adequately for assigned classes, providing written evidence of preparation when requested by the supervisor as stipulated in the teaching contract.

6. Utilizes a range of teaching methods and educational resources, considering the physical constraints of the location and the needs of the students.

7. Actively works to implement the district's educational philosophy, instructional goals, and performance standards through teaching practices.

8. Regularly evaluates student progress, providing necessary reports and maintaining communication with parents as needed.

9. Keeps accurate and complete records as mandated by law, district policy, and administrative guidelines.

10. Identifies learning challenges faced by students, seeking assistance from district specialists when necessary.

11. Ensures the safety of students, equipment, materials, and facilities through reasonable precautions.

12. Adheres to the district's code of conduct for classrooms, establishing fair and just rules of behavior.

13. Plans and oversees the work of paraprofessionals, providing written evaluations as required.

14. Engages in ongoing professional development that meets district requirements and personal professional goals.

15. Participates actively in the teacher evaluation process, contributing to a mutual understanding of evaluation outcomes.

16. Attends meetings at the building and district level to foster communication and collaborative decision-making among staff.

17. Participates in school-sponsored events and activities as agreed upon with the administration.

18. Contributes to district and building decisions regarding budget, facilities, curriculum, and overall well-being.

19. Strives to enhance and maintain professional competence.

QUALIFICATIONS:

1. Must be highly qualified with the necessary expertise in the subject area; and

2. Possess the appropriate educator license for teaching students with moderate disabilities and relevant grade level licensure from the Massachusetts Department of Elementary and Secondary Education; and

3. Hold a Bachelor's Degree with the required license; or

4. A Master's Degree with the appropriate content area license is preferred and/or expected within five years.
